What do you mean by calendar days when we book?
Most campervan operators in New Zealand charge by the day, not per 24 hour period. So regardless of the time of collection and return, you will be charged for the day you collect and the day you drop your vehicle off.

What is the safe travel speed for driving the campervans?
The open road speed limit is 100km/hour for the 2 berth campervans and 90km/hour for the 4 and 6 berth motorhomes. We suggests a more comfortable speed for driving your campervan is below the maximum allowed speed, especially if you have never driven one before. Should you choose to travel below the speed limit, please show courtesy to other road users by allowing them to pass.

How much fuel am I likely to use on my holiday?
This all depends on how far you travel! As a rough guide, most 2 berth campervans use around 12 litres per 100kms and 4 and 6 berth motorhomes use around 14 liters per 100kms.

How long does the LPG last?
If you are free camping you may use a 9kg gas bottle every 10 days with average use.

Can I park and sleep in the campervan wherever I want, or do I have to stay in a campground?
It is not always necessary to go to a camp ground. It is acceptable to stop on the side of the road or in a bush reserve as long as there are no signs saying "No Parking/Overnight Camping". Use common sense and courtesy. Please remember to take any rubbish for proper disposal later.
Camp grounds usually charge around NZ$15 - $20 per night per person.

Does Find A Camper supply a list of campgrounds around New Zealand?
Yes, we supply camp ground & regional guides as well as comprehensive New Zealand road maps on request. Most rental companies will provide these on collection of your campervan.

Do I have to pre-book camping parks?
It is rare for powered sites to be full at camping parks. The only time it may be a problem is over the Christmas/New Year period continuing to the end of the second week of January and also the first two weeks of February. Bookings may be wise in some of the key tourist centres also.

Do I have to pre-book the ferry service across Cook Strait?
During the peak summer season, from December to March, it is advisable to pre-book ferry services in advance. We would be happy to arrange this for you before you arrive. What does the rental insurance cover?
The rental insurance cover restricts the maximum you are liable for in the event of an accident as long as you do not break the rental agreement terms and conditions. It does not cover you for any personal loss or injury. We strongly suggest taking your own personal travel insurance in addition to rental insurance.

If I have an accident and I am at fault, will I lose my entire excess?
You will be liable for up to the amount of your excess towards the repair cost. If the damage is minor, you will only be charged the repair costs and not the entire excess. Please check individual rental company's Terms and Conditions for full details.

What happens if I have an accident and it's not my fault?
In the event that something happens to the campervan and you are not at fault, (either a vehicle accident where someone strikes the vehicle or damage occurs while the vehicle is parked) you are liable for the damage caused to the vehicle until the renal company is able to receive payment for those damages from the third party.
